Biological Background: OsBip1 Function and Localization
- OsBip1 (Heat shock 70 kDa protein BIP1, also known as Luminal-binding protein 1) is a member of the Hsp70 chaperone family encoded by the BIP1 gene in rice.
- It functions as a molecular chaperone in the endoplasmic reticulum (ER) lumen, facilitating the folding of nascent secretory proteins.
- OsBip1 plays a critical role in ER quality control, ensuring proper folding of seed storage proteins during seed maturation. Related references: PMID:19567376 PMID:21223397
- It acts as a sensor of ER stress, helping to alleviate stress and providing suitable conditions for secretory protein production. Related references: PMID:19567376 PMID:21223397
- The protein is localized to the endoplasmic reticulum lumen.
- Key features include ATP-binding, nucleotide-binding, and glycoprotein modifications, and it is classified under stress response pathways.
- The predicted molecular weight is approximately 73.4 kDa, consistent with the observed band at 73 kDa in rice samples.
Experimental Guidance and Technical Tips
- The immunogen corresponds to amino acids 300-400, a region that may provide specificity for OsBip1 detection; consider using this information when designing ELISA assays or when troubleshooting cross-reactivity.
- For Western blotting, a band around 73 kDa is expected in Oryza sativa samples; validate with a negative control (e.g., knockout or unrelated tissue) to confirm target specificity.
- ELISA optimization may benefit from coating with the recombinant immunogen fragment; include appropriate controls such as pre-immune serum or antigen-blocked wells.
- If cross-reactivity with other species is desired, sequence alignment of the immunogen region is recommended, though the antibody is currently validated only for Oryza sativa.
